Standout Feature

Proprietary AI engine that extracts and quantifies ESG risks from unstructured multilingual sources in real-time

RepRisk is a premier AI-driven ESG risk analytics platform that monitors reputational risks related to environmental, social, and governance issues by scanning over 50,000 global media and stakeholder sources in 26 languages daily. It delivers real-time alerts, quantitative risk ratings, and customizable analytics for companies, projects, countries, and suppliers, enabling proactive risk mitigation. Trusted by major asset managers, banks, and corporations, it transforms unstructured data into actionable ESG insights to support investment decisions and compliance.

Standout Feature

ESG Risk Ratings methodology, which scores unmanaged sustainability risks on a 0-100 scale tailored to 20 industry-specific material issues

Sustainalytics is a leading ESG research and ratings provider offering a robust platform for assessing and managing ESG risks across global companies and portfolios. It delivers in-depth ESG Risk Ratings, controversy monitoring, and analytics tools to help investors identify material sustainability risks and opportunities. The solution supports portfolio benchmarking, stewardship engagement, and regulatory reporting, backed by expert research on over 14,500 companies worldwide.

Standout Feature

Norm-Based Research and Screening (NBRS), which evaluates companies against international sustainability norms and UN Global Compact principles for precise risk identification.

ISS ESG, from Institutional Shareholder Services, delivers comprehensive ESG data, ratings, and analytics to institutional investors for managing environmental, social, and governance risks across global portfolios. The platform provides over 300 metrics, controversy alerts, norm-based screening, and climate transition tools to support investment decision-making and stewardship. It integrates seamlessly with proxy voting data, enabling robust risk assessment and compliance with regulatory standards like SFDR and TCFD.

Standout Feature

The Novata Index, providing standardized peer benchmarking across 10,000+ private market companies for relative ESG performance assessment

Novata is a specialized ESG data management platform tailored for private markets, including private equity, venture capital, and real assets, helping general partners (GPs) and limited partners (LPs) collect, standardize, and analyze ESG data across portfolios. It supports regulatory compliance like SFDR and SEC rules, offers peer benchmarking via the Novata Index, and provides climate risk analytics to identify and mitigate ESG risks. The platform emphasizes streamlined data workflows with AI-powered validation and customizable reporting for actionable insights.

Standout Feature

Proprietary S-Ray score that delivers a single, quantifiable ESG risk metric using AI and non-traditional data sources

Arabesque S-Ray is an AI-powered ESG analytics platform that provides quantitative risk assessments for over 5,000 global companies across environmental, social, and governance factors. It leverages alternative data sources like patents, job postings, and supply chain information, combined with machine learning, to deliver forward-looking ESG risk scores and benchmarks. The tool helps investors, asset managers, and corporations integrate sustainability risks into decision-making processes.

Standout Feature

Wdata linked reporting, which automatically propagates data changes across interconnected ESG and financial documents for consistency.

Workiva is a cloud-based platform specializing in connected reporting for financial, compliance, and ESG disclosures. It enables organizations to collect, manage, and report ESG data from disparate sources, with automated workflows for assurance and regulatory filings. While strong in data integration and consistency, it focuses more on reporting and disclosure than advanced risk modeling or predictive analytics.
